You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@unomi.apache.org by "Damon Henry (JIRA)" <ji...@apache.org> on 2017/05/18 20:10:04 UTC

[jira] [Created] (UNOMI-97) Conditions Spanning Multiple Types

Damon Henry created UNOMI-97:
--------------------------------

             Summary: Conditions Spanning Multiple Types
                 Key: UNOMI-97
                 URL: https://issues.apache.org/jira/browse/UNOMI-97
             Project: Apache Unomi
          Issue Type: Test
          Components: core
    Affects Versions: 1.2.0-incubating
            Reporter: Damon Henry
            Priority: Minor
             Fix For: 1.2.0-incubating


I'm attempting to create boolean conditions that retrieve unique profile counts but I may be interpreting the documentation incorrectly. A contrived example is asking the context server to give me all profiles performing a page view event. The example below provides the expected result when querying the *event* type but return 0 when querying the *profile* type.

Is there a method to build segments using attributes from profiles, sessions, and events?

http://localhost/cxs/query/event/count (return expected correct number of events)
http://localhost/cxs/query/event/count (returns zero; should this return unique profiles)
{code}
{
	  "parameterValues": {
		"operator": "and",
		"subConditions": [
		  {
			"parameterValues": {
			  "propertyValue": "page",
			  "comparisonOperator": "equals",
			  "propertyName": "target.itemType"
			},
			"type": "eventPropertyCondition"
		  },
		  {
			"parameterValues": {
			  "propertyValue": "view",
			  "comparisonOperator": "equals",
			  "propertyName": "eventType"
			},
			"type": "eventPropertyCondition"
		  }
		]
	  },
	  "type": "booleanCondition"
	}
{code}



--
This message was sent by Atlassian JIRA
(v6.3.15#6346)